When it comes to choosing the right bed slats for your mattress, LVL (Laminated Veneer Lumber) bed slats are a popular choice due to their durability and strength. Understanding what LVL bed slats are and their benefits can help you make an informed decision when shopping for a new bed frame.

LVL bed slats are made from layers of thin wood veneers that are glued together under high pressure. This process results in a strong and stable material that is resistant to warping and bending. Unlike traditional solid wood slats, LVL slats offer consistent support and are less likely to break or sag over time.

One of the main benefits of LVL bed slats is their superior strength. The laminated construction of LVL slats provides better support for your mattress and helps distribute weight evenly, reducing the risk of damage to your mattress. This can help prolong the life of your mattress and provide a more comfortable sleeping surface.

In addition to their strength, LVL bed slats are also highly durable. The manufacturing process used to create LVL slats results in a material that is resistant to moisture, pests, and decay. This makes LVL slats a long-lasting and low-maintenance option for your bed frame.

Another advantage of LVL bed slats is their versatility. LVL slats can be customized to fit different bed frame sizes and styles, making them suitable for a variety of mattresses and bed frames. Whether you have a twin, full, queen, or king-size bed, LVL slats can be tailored to provide the right level of support for your specific needs.

When considering LVL bed slats for your bed frame, it is important to take into account a few key considerations. First, make sure to check the weight capacity of the LVL slats to ensure they can adequately support your mattress and body weight. This will help prevent the slats from bending or breaking under pressure.

Second, consider the spacing of the LVL slats. The spacing between slats can impact the level of support and comfort provided by your bed frame. Ideally, slats should be placed close together to provide even support for your mattress and prevent it from sagging.

Lastly, take into account the overall design and construction of the bed frame when choosing LVL slats. Make sure that the slats are compatible with the frame and that they can be easily installed and removed if needed.
